Bayern Munich head coach Julian Nagelsmann has, on Friday evening, confirmed an ongoing personnel blow amongst his ranks.
The player set for a continued spell on the sidelines? Manuel Neuer.
Bayern are primed to return to action on Saturday afternoon, when they make the trip to Hoffenheim for a Bundesliga clash.
Boss Nagelsmann, in turn, held his latest press conference on Friday evening, with the subject of injury news having taken its place centre stage.
The German champions are already without a number of key performers at present, with Leroy Sane and Lucas Hernandez amongst those expected to sit out the weekend’s action at the Rhein-Neckar-Arena.

And joining such high-profile stars on the absentee list of late, as alluded to above, has been Manuel Neuer, too.
This comes after hope had spread that Neuer would return to the fray on Saturday, to replace Sven Ulreich between the posts once more.
This, however, will in fact not be the case.
Instead, Nagelsmann has confirmed that the German international has been ruled out of not only the latest round of Bundesliga fixtures, but, in all likelihood, Bayern’s Champions League showdown with Spanish giants Barcelona next Wednesday, too.
“Manuel Neuer won’t play,” the Bavarians’ boss announced. “He’s still feeling some pain. It’s looking like he will also miss the game against Barcelona.”
